INFORMATION SYSTEMS OFFICER (Temporary Job Opening)
Organizational Context
This position is within the Automated System for Customs Data (ASYCUDA) Programme, part of the Division on Technology and Logistics (DTL) at the United Nations Conference on Trade and Development (UNCTAD). Located in Amman, Jordan, the Information Systems Officer reports to the ASYCUDA Regional Coordinator for the Arab Countries, Democratic Republic of the Congo (DRC), and Haiti Region.
Job Purpose
The Information Systems Officer will provide crucial technical assistance and support to National Customs Services (NCS) and National Project Teams (NPT). This role involves managing projects from feasibility studies through to implementation of moderately complex systems, and contributing to larger development teams. The officer will develop detailed system specifications, user documentation, and specialized advice for customs digitalization initiatives. Key responsibilities include maintaining and upgrading existing ASYCUDA systems, troubleshooting issues, and ensuring the effective performance of assigned systems. The role also encompasses developing and maintaining proprietary ASYCUDA programs, managing data security, conducting system testing, and developing training materials and disaster recovery plans.

Work Experience
A minimum of five years of progressive experience in planning, design, development, implementation, and maintenance of computer information systems is required. Relevant experience in customs digitalization, system deployment, development, and support is essential. Desirable experience includes prototyping and implementing complex customs IT systems, organizing and delivering training, working in an international environment, and technical ICT programming with Java, Linux, and Oracle.
